The advice in ''Throw It Away'' comes from what she called a ''magic book, '' the I Ching, but it also recalls the period of her life when she thought she had disposed of her marriage and career. To pay tribute to Lincoln's life and music, three of the most influential jazz divas in the country are convening in Washington, D. C. tonight for the annual Mary Lou Williams Women in Jazz Festival at the Kennedy Center, where they will interpret some of Abbey Lincoln's most beloved songs.

Holiday may have written just a small amount of material -- including the song ''Fine and Mellow'' and the lyrics to ''Don't Explain'' and ''God Bless the Child'' -- but those songs endure as quintessential representations of her art and life.
